Our Gate Parts & Welding Services in Barberton
Hinge Replacement
Barberton’s 40-plus inches of annual rainfall chews through unpainted steel hinges in three to five years. We regularly find hinges rusted through at the barrel while the gate itself looks fine — especially on older post-and-board setups along the 98662 corridor. We replace with galvanized or stainless steel hinges sized for your gate’s actual weight, not what the original builder guessed. A typical hinge replacement in Barberton runs $180–$320 for a standard residential gate, $340–$520 for heavy agricultural gates.

Post Replacement
This is our most common call in Barberton, and for good reason. Prolonged wet winters rot wood gate posts at the soil line — we often find post bases completely decayed while the top of the gate looks fine. The mid-century rural parcels and 1980s suburban infill around Barberton are full of cedar and pressure-treated posts that have soaked up decades of Clark County moisture. We set new posts in gravel drainage or concrete piers depending on soil conditions, and we’ll tell you straight if your post is salvageable or if replacement is the honest call. Post replacement in Barberton typically costs $380–$650 for wood, $520–$890 for steel.

Rail Repair & Gate Rollers
Heavy driveway gates on Barberton’s gravel access roads torque out of alignment from constant truck traffic, bending rollers and stressing latch mechanisms. We stock steel and nylon rollers for slide gates up to 20 feet, and we carry track brackets that we can custom-weld on-site if your frame has warped. Roller replacement runs $220–$400; bent rail straightening or section replacement starts at $340 and scales with gate length and access difficulty.

Custom Welding
Here’s where Barberton’s rural character really shows. We field-weld steel track brackets, repair bent receiver posts, fabricate custom latch mounts for odd-angle installations, and reinforce gate frames that have taken a hit from farm equipment. Our mobile welding rig runs 220V stick and MIG, ready for everything from a cracked ¼-inch bracket to a full 2-inch post splice. Custom welding in Barberton starts at $280 for simple bracket fabrication and runs to $750-plus for extensive frame repair or custom gate builds.

Common Gate Parts & Welding Problems We See in Barberton Homes
- Wood post rot at the soil line. Clark County’s wet season lasts October through April, and gate posts set in Barberton’s clay-heavy soil stay perpetually damp. We pull posts that look sound above ground but are hollow at the base — a failure mode that’s invisible until the gate sags or the latch won’t meet.
- Steel hinge and latch rust-through. Unpainted hardware oxidizes fast here. We replace with hot-dip galvanized or 316 stainless hinges that laugh at 40 inches of rain, and we drill weep holes in post caps so water doesn’t pool and accelerate the cycle.
- Gravel-road gate misalignment. Constant truck traffic on long Barberton driveways torques slide gate frames and wears rollers unevenly. We realign tracks, shim posts, and upgrade to heavier-duty rollers rated for the actual cycle count and load.
- Undersized openers on heavy gates. The 1980s–2000s suburban infill around Barberton often has 14- to 16-foot gates with openers spec’d for half the weight. We upgrade to properly rated systems — Viking or FAAC for heavy slide gates, Ghost Controls for lighter residential swing setups — and custom-weld mounting brackets when the original bolt pattern doesn’t match.

In Barberton, it’s usually the post base rotted below grade, not the hinge — though a rusted hinge can accelerate the sag by allowing the gate to rack. We probe the post with a spade or rebar to check for hollow pockets at the soil line; if it’s sound, we realign and upgrade the hinges. If it’s rotted, replacement is the only honest fix.
